Here's the part of his logic I have an issue with:

quote:

Dating to 1994, the Saints have started a Pro Bowl-caliber player at left tackle every season. The lone exceptions were 2003, 2004 and 2005 when veteran Wayne Gandy was signed to bridge the gap between Kyle Turley and Jammal Brown.
quote:

The run ended when Bushrod signed with the Chicago Bears in March free agency.

Bushrod wasn't named to the Pro Bowl until 2011, but got the starting job in 2009. By his logic of having a Pro bowler every year at LT, Armstead (or any other OT on the roster), could start this year, become a Pro Bowler in 2 or 3 years, and not have the run ended.

My biggest concern with our O-Line isn't necessarily the tackle question mark. Mine is the loss of Carl Nicks last year, and here's why.

In 2011 we were #3 at running the ball (I think), and the best in the NFL at average yards per carry. So when we ran the ball we did it well. Last year our offense was very one-dimensional. A lot of people have used "no Sean Payton", "trying to offset a record-setting loser defense", blah blah blah. But the games I watched last year indicated that we had issues running the ball up the middle. The only times our backs got 3+ yards was when they would bounce it to the outside and try to beat the containment. Most times it was: 1st down, run the ball for 2 yards. 2nd Down: Pass. 3rd Down: Pass.

Do I think Grubbs is bad? Absolutely not, but I think he hasn't fully meshed with the other two guys yet. Now that Kromer is gone we can only hope that our O-Line continues to develop. I hope this year we see improvement in up-the-middle running game. Bushrod was good at getting a lead block on the outside run plays too. I just hope Brown/whoever can keep up.

Last year we ranked 13th in ypc with 4.3. In 2011 we ranked 5th in ypc with 4.9. In 2010 we ranked 19th in ypc with 4.0. In 2009 we ranked 7th in ypc with 4.5.

Guess which years we ranked 20th or better in attempts, and which years we ranked 28th or lower in attempts.

It has a ton to do with if you are playing from behind and if you are trying to close the game out with the run. Nicks is not that much greater than Grubbs in the run, if he is even better in the first place. Tampa still ran very well without him.
